The Cáca Milis Cabaret, back from its trip last month for the Second Annual Cabaret Ceilteach in Wales, will be rocking the Wexford Arts Centre this coming Friday night again with a little something to celebrate the longer evenings.  Helena Mulkerns present a packed evening of the arts, as usual, and will be backed by fabulous Featherhead Trio, who will play out the evening with their own magic.

Special Guests are Artist and Writer Waylon White Deer of Choctaw Nation and Kate Dempsey – Diva of the Poetic Persuasion!!

To kick start the evening, we’ll have the lovely Eva Barbiarczyk of Khelashi Dance followed by Chanteuse Cat Black in fine form, along with fellow singer-songwriter Shane Hurley, who is celebrating the release of a brand new CD (available at the show).  Our Ciné Sweetcake is a beautiful Bealtaine short film by award-winning Director Conor Horgan and dancer David Bolger called, “Swimming with My Mother.”

Waylon White Deer – more familiarly known to Irish friends as Gary – has exhibited his paintings worldwide, and is also a Choctaw tribal chanter and dance master.  His non-fiction works include a history of the Choctaw Nation, Chahta Bilia Hoke; an Overview of Choctaw History and a soon-to-be published novel, Spirits in the Rain. Writer and Poet Kate Dempsey, whose poems “The Dinky Poetry Book, Some Poems,” was published by Moss Editions in 2011, writes the popular blog Emerging Writer.blogspot.com and also founded the dazzling, delectable Poetry Divas.

The Venue
With a stunning location nestled between the Sugar Loaf Mountain and Dublin Bay, Killruddery House & Gardens is one of Ireland’s best kept secrets. Widely known as the “Gateway to the Garden of Ireland”.

The Course
The 10KM course will be the same as in 2011, starting in front of the magnificient Killruddery House, one of the most successfully restored EIizabethan-Revival mansions in Ireland.

The course is primarily an off-road trail course – the perfect opportunity to get off the pavement and add variety to your run training. Instead of cars and noisy traffic, you will have the pleasant sight of Killruddery’s farm livestock in the neighbouring fields! We recommend that you wear trail runners because, if the course is wet, you may lose traction if you’re wearing normal road runners.

Locked into Devils Glen

Funny story… myself and my sister went for a gorgeous walk in Devils Glen , Ashford yesterday ( Saturday 14th April). As we drove in we acknowledged the sign that read: Gates Close at 5pm.

We drove up to the carpark as we wanted to see if the masses of bluebells had come out yet.. ( not quite is the answer) and then set off for a long walk down to the waterfall and back…HOWEVER, we got a teeny bit confused and ended up walking for two hours whereupon when we returned we realised that it was now 5.45 and the gates may be closed.

We drove as fast we could ( 25mph on that road) and lo and behold the gates were indeed locked tight. What to do?…

Unfortunately there is no notice of what to do in this case- the notice board does have a contact tel for the Coillte Newtownmountkennedy office, but that’s no use if its after 5pm or a weekend!

The answer:

We rang Ashford garda station who took our number and got back to us via Wicklow garda station, The Wicklow station did indeed have a key and woud be on their way out to us promptly! PHEW!

Ten minutes later we were free again with thanks to the two guards who came out to open the gate ( in the rain)

So a HUGE Thank You to the Wicklow guards and I hope this info can be of help to some other unfortunate souls in the future!

Wicklow Guards: +353(0)404 60140

Still, was an adventure my sis won’t forget! :)
